The history of Grand-Olan

In the early 19th century, Charles Meunier received a recipe from the Carthusian monk Dom Emmanuel Nivière for an elixir made by distilling 23 aromatic plants.
This recipe was marketed a few years later in the form of a liqueur called Grand-Olan, in reference to the peak in the Alps where some of the plants in the recipe flower. The recipe for this liqueur has remained strictly unchanged ever since.

Grand-Olan, with its naturally golden colour, can be enjoyed as an after-dinner drink (serve in a tasting glass or wine glass, slightly chilled or over ice) or in cocktails.

On the palate, this liqueur has a very long-lasting aroma. The herbaceous flavours are followed by spicy, peppery aromas.

 

A modern design for traditional markers

Juliette Villard, a graphic designer and painter based in Isère, specialises in historic brands and houses. She brings her graphic and artistic skills to bear, offering support that combines a contemporary and manual approach, and draws her inspiration from studying archives.

To create this new bottle, we had to delve into the historic bottles of the Distillerie Meunier. As Juliette says: "go back into history to create the future".

The aim was to create a simple label, faithful to the 'iconic' Grand Olan bottle that had been selected as a model, with some ornamentation. Drawing on history to bring out the emotion of an era.

A study of the archives of all the Meunier liqueurs was therefore undertaken, and many of the House's historical elements and codes came to light. 

As part of her creative process, Juliette took her best pencil and drew all the elements of the label by hand, using the historical codes as a starting point. It's a manual process that allows us to rediscover this authenticity, and highlights the heritage of the Maison Meunier, in particular that of Grand-Olan.

Juliette's meticulous work blends tradition and modernity, and is an intrinsic part of the Distillery's expertise.

A modernised design with traditional markers, in a nod to this historic recipe.


The bottle, for its part, offers a promise of experience, wonder and the extraordinary. It has been chosen to be the same as the entire Génépis Meunier collection: N°1, Altitude and Héritage, as well as Gin and Suc des Glaciers.
